Car keys are surprisingly fragile and easily misplaced. Whether due to keys jamming in the ignition, left inside a mislocked compartment, or lost during transit, the consequences can extend far beyond frustration. When keys go missing, repair costs often include locksmith fees, professional diagnosis, and part replacements—sometimes totaling $200–$800 or more, depending on your vehicle. Yet many drivers overlook simple damage waiver programs and insurance add-ons designed to cushion such losses. That’s where smart hacks come in—trusted, real-world methods that significantly reduce out-of-pocket expenses after a key incident.
